5.1.7.8 UPnP Setup
Universal Plug and Play (UPnP) integrates a universal protocol for
widespread plug-and-play devices to ease the network implementation. When
a PC and the
DVR-4TH/ 8TH/ 16TH
series unit both installed the UPnP
function, the PC can automatically recognize the
DVR-4TH/ 8TH/ 16TH
series
unit in the same local area network.
UPnP Setup
1. UPnP
2. UPnP NAT Traversal
ON
No
UPnP
Select <ON> to enable the UPnP function, or select <OFF> to disable UPnP.
UPnP NAT Traversal
The UPnP NAT traversal function will help to automatically setup a router if
the
DVR-4TH/ 8TH/ 16TH
series unit connects to the internet via a router.
Select <Yes> to enable, or else select <No> to disable.
